Job Overview

AdventHealth is seeking a Clinical Registration Staffing Coordinator to ensure timely and accurate patient registration and insurance verification. The role is full‑time, Monday to Friday, 8:00am – 4:30pm, located at 4200 Sun N Lake Blvd, Sebring, FL 33872. The coordinator will maintain relationships with clinical partners to enhance patient experience, organize coverage during absences, and coordinate with case management when needed.
Responsibilities

Maintain open communication with clinical, ancillary, and consumer access departments.
Provide continuous coverage of the assigned registration area.
Arrange relief coverage during extended absences.
Contact insurance companies by phone, fax, online portal, and other resources to obtain and verify eligibility and benefits before scheduled appointments.
Register patients for all services, ensuring accurate demographics.
Perform Medicare compliance reviews, eligibility checks, and complete Medicare Secondary Payer Questionnaires.
Assign appropriate payer plans and update financial assessments, eligibility, and benefits.
Create accurate estimates to maximize up‑front cash collections; add collections documentation when required.
Coordinate with case management staff when pre‑authorization is not obtained for an inpatient stay.
Maintain the department invoice process, including receiving, validating, filing, and processing invoices for payment.
Document all conversations with patients and insurance representatives in the appropriate fields.
Perform other duties as assigned.
